Abstract

The invention discloses a marine casting soldering method. The method comprises the following steps of a preparing stage, i.e. selecting a welding strip; forming a welding seam beveled edge, i.e. forming an opened welding seam beveled edge, removing a crack source, and meanwhile making the two ends of the crack source arc-shaped; welding a welding seam, i.e. welding the welding seam by using the baked welding strip of which the model is E5015 and the diameter is 4mm, wherein an electrode manipulation way is a reciprocating way as well as a swinging way, and pre-heating the welding seam and fully filling the melting side of the welding seam in a reciprocating way, wherein the swinging way can promote the fusion of the edge of the welding seam; and performing oil quenching through butter. The welding strip is selected and processed, meanwhile the corresponding electrode manipulation way is adopted to weld the welding seam, the key point is that the oil quenching way is adopted, and a casting is soldered by an ordinary welding strip. The method is low in soldering cost, good in soldering effect and convenient to operate, and does not easily fail, and the soldering time is shortened, so that construction is guaranteed to be performed orderly.

Description

Boats and ships mending of iron castings method
Technical field
The present invention relates to technical field of ships, is a kind of boats and ships mending of iron castings method specifically.
Background technology
Ship structure design is tight, and the cast iron welded unit is more, causes some defectives when cast iron welds easily.Especially heavy castings, under the help of simulation casting, though reduced most defective, because actual operate miss, being difficult to control of high-temperature molten steel all can make foundry goods produce various defectives, such as crackle or the like, influences the performance of foundry goods.In order to repair these defectives, generally adopt soldering to carry out the repairing of defective, soldering also is a method for repairing and mending the most common, most convenient.
In the prior art, mainly adopt welding cast iron to vulcanize and two kinds of repair weldings of cast iron cold-patch for the repair welding of cast iron welding.Cast iron is vulcanized the soldering position that often is subjected to equipment, shelve the place, and the restriction of factor such as natural environment, the heating condition harshness of casting iron hot-weld often shows as the outside heat height simultaneously, the inner non-uniform phenomenon that does not reach, the thickness of cast iron itself is thicker, and cooling velocity is very fast, needs the heating of side weld limit, make operation easier strengthen, easily cause the generation of white structure and cause the soldering failure.The cast iron cold-patch is had higher requirement to the selection of welding material except that to the technological requirement strictness, does not have slightly can soldering to fail at once, thereby increased the expense of soldering, iron weld repair is failure in a single day, and the difficulty of soldering is just bigger once more, and successful probability is also just low more.
At above two kinds of technologies, because it requires height to technical quality and equipment, time-consuming, cost is also higher relatively, meets key equipment and damages, and also can cause stop work and production, causes damage to enterprise.
Summary of the invention
The technical problem to be solved in the present invention is to provide the electric welding of a kind of employing common welding rod, the boats and ships mending of iron castings method that realization is low-cost, technical quality is high.
Technical solution of the present invention is, a kind of boats and ships mending of iron castings method of following structure is provided, and may further comprise the steps:
1) preparatory stage: selecting model for use is E4303, and diameter is the formation of the welding rod of 3.2mm as weld groove; Selecting model for use is E5015, and diameter is that the welding rod of 4mm is made welding usefulness, and is placed on and adopts the temperature constant temperature more than 350 degrees centigrade to cure in the incubator 1~2 hour;
2) formation of weld groove: the employing model is E4303, and diameter is that the welding rod of 3.2mm is done and snapped the seam groove, removes formation of crack, and making the formation of crack both ends simultaneously is circular arc;
3) weld seam welding: with the model of having cured is E5015, diameter is that the welding rod butt welded seam of 4mm welds, the mode of arc manipulation is the reciprocating type teeter formula that adds back and forth, and reciprocating type back and forth butt welded seam carries out preheating and fills up edge-melting, and the teeter formula then can promote the fusion on joint edge edge;
4) oil quenching: when weld seam operation end foundry goods still is in the red heat state, cover with butter immediately, in the process that butter covers, should be noted that the sound that has or not metal, do not have the then soldering success of words of metal sound.
Adopt above method, the present invention compared with prior art has the following advantages: adopt the present invention, by the selection and the processing of welding rod, use corresponding manipulation of electrode butt welded seam simultaneously and weld, key is to have used the oil quenching technology, finishes the soldering of common welding rod to foundry goods; Soldering cost of the present invention is low, and welding effect is good, and is easy to operate, is difficult for breaking down, and has shortened the time of soldering, thereby ensures carrying out in order of construction.
As improvement, in step 4, when butter covers, use hammering method that hammering is carried out at the soldering position, eliminate welding stress and crystal grain thinning, when butter is cooled to 500 degrees centigrade, stop hammering, the butter that solidifies gradually plays insulation effect to the soldering position; The design of this step combines oil quenching and hammering are effective, can effectively remove welding stress and crystal grain thinning, reduces the white structure of commissure, thereby has improved welding effect.
As improvement, multilayer when welding, with weld interpass temperature at 200~500 degrees centigrade; Because when interlayer temperature was low, weld seam cooled off easy cracking under field conditions (factors), cause the soldering failure, interlayer temperature is too high, and then service speed is difficult to catch up with, and this number range had both improved the success rate of soldering.

Butter has the possibility of burning in the step 4, should be noted that to increase butter at any time.
In step 4, when butter covers, use hammering method that hammering is carried out at the soldering position, eliminate welding stress and crystal grain thinning, when butter is cooled to 500 degrees centigrade, stop hammering, the butter that solidifies gradually plays insulation effect to the soldering position.
Multilayer when welding, with weld interpass temperature at 200~500 degrees centigrade; Because when interlayer temperature was low, weld seam cooled off easy cracking under field conditions (factors), cause the soldering failure, interlayer temperature is too high, and then service speed is difficult to catch up with, and therefore interlayer temperature is arranged in this number range.
When iron weld repair, make sure to keep in mind and can not carry out, as have the place of draught in the excessive place of wind-force, when running into wind-force, barrier should be set stop wind or suspend soldering work greater than 2m/s.
Method of the present invention not only can be used for the soldering of boats and ships itself, also is applicable on the cast steel equipment of boats and ships simultaneously, because in the process of transportation, may cause damage to this equipment, can adopt this method that cast steel equipment is carried out soldering.
